:confused:can anyone tell me how long this will last for to still be visible only asking because have only just bought my telescope and not sure how long will be able to see it with a skywatcher 127mm synscan,thanks for any advice

It's very hard to see right now because of the full moon. M 101, or the Pinwheel Galaxy is not the easiest galaxy to find out there because it is faint to start out with. I believe it will be visible later on this month but will become dimmer as time progresses. I tried to look at it last night but the glow of the moon washed out all of my efforts
